And the winner is...

The "Level 1" Contest was a race to see who would be the first MMVS students to receive their Level 1 Certifications for Mel's Vocal Program.  Level 1 requirements are listed on this blog's list of links on the right hand side.  They include practice time, blog posting, anatomy of the voice, music theory, song projects and performance evaluations.  1st, 2nd and 3rd place winners won prizes including a free hour lesson at MMVS, free attendance to a performance workshop, awesome iPod ear buds, mad bragging rights, and a featured video on the MMVS youtube channel.
